The African Financial Alliance on Climate Change (AFAC) in partnership with The Secretariat of Making Finance Work for Africa Partnership (MFW4A), the African Development Bank (AfDB) , the Global Center on Adaptation (GCA), United Nations Environmental Programme Financial Initiative (UNEP-FI), The Global Financial Alliance on Net Zero (GFANZ) and Financial Sector Deepening Africa (FSD Africa) organized an event on "Mobilizing Africa's Financial Sector for Low-carbon and Climate-resilient Development".
The event attracted participants from major financial institutions on the African continent and development institutions working to transition Africa's financial industry to a low-carbon, climate-resilient economy, including African commercial and development banks, institutional investors, financial regulators, and supporting organizations and networks such as GCA, UNEP-FI, GFANZ, FSD Africa and MFW4A. it also served as a platform to secure collective commitment to the realization of AFAC's Vision 2030 and Strategy 2023-2027, and to secure high-level support and endorsement of the proposed governance structure and work program.
